Extension and compensating cables, multi-paired version - suitable for use in temperature measurement and manufacturing process control

Version SY - Armoured against
mechanical loads
Version ST - Screened against electro-
magnetical interference

Product Make-up

  • Version Y:
    - Fine-wire conductor alloy
    - PVC core insulation
    - Cores twisted into layers
    - PVC outer sheath
  • Version SY:
    - Design as version Y
    - Additional galvanised steel wire braiding
    - PVC outer sheath
  • Version ST:
    - Design as verison Y
    - Cores twisted in pairs,
    pairs twisted in layers
    - Aluminium foil screening + drain wire
    - PVC outer sheath
  • Design, for example PVC-PVC-S-PVC:
    - PVC core insulation
    - PVC inner sheath
    - Steel wire braiding
    - PVC outer sheath
  • Design, for example PVC-ST-PVC:
    - PVC core insulation
    - STatic foil screen
    - PVC outer sheath
  • Colour identity code
    DIN 43710
    Negative conductor and outer sheath:
    Fe/CuNi: blue
    NiCr/Ni: green
    PtRh/Pt: white
    Positive conductor: always red
    IEC 60 584
    Positive conductor and outer sheath:
    Fe/CuNi: black
    NiCr/Ni: green
    PtRh/Pt: orange
    Negative conductor: always white
  • Extension-conductor alloys are identified
    with X, e.g. JX (Fe/CuNi)
    Compensating-conductor alloys are
    identified with C, e.g. KCA (NiCr/Ni)

Core identification code

  • From 4 cores in pairs with consecutively marked numbers (1-1, 2-2, 3-3, 4-4...)

Based on

  • Limiting deviation in accordance with DIN and IEC in accordance with class 2

Conductor stranding

  • 48 x 0.20 mm

Minimum bending radius

  • For flexible use:
    12.5 x outer diameter
    Type SY with steel braid:
    15 x outer diameter
    Type ST with foil screen:
    15 x outer diameter

Temperature range

  • (referring to insulation and sheath material)
    Flexing: -5°C to +80°C
  • Fixed installation: -40°C to +80°C
